Deferred Maintenance: A Risky Gamble

One of the most tempting traps small airlines fall into is deferred maintenance. It may seem logical to delay certain maintenance tasks to save money in the short term, especially when budgets are tight. However, this approach backfires in most cases. What starts as a minor issue (e.g. cracks in combustion liner) can quickly escalate into a major engine failure (combustion liner material detaching causing significant downstream damage), increasing cost by multiples of an initial repair and leading to extended downtime.

The lesson is clear: while deferring maintenance might offer short-term relief, it often leads to long-term financial pain. Small airlines must prioritize regular maintenance to prevent small problems from spiraling into expensive shop visits.

Underestimating Component Degradation

One of the most overlooked aspects of engine maintenance is the gradual degradation of engine components. Over time, as engines accumulate flying hours, critical parts such as hot section components and bearings begin are exposed to attrition. For small airlines, monitoring the deterioration, e.g. through borescope inspections, is essential in avoiding unscheduled removals and the high repair costs associated with them.

The financial impact of unmonitored component degradation can be devastating. For example, if a turbine blade is allowed to degrade past its safe operating limit, it could fail in-flight, requiring not only expensive repairs but also grounding the aircraft for extended periods. Such an event could lead to lost revenue from canceled flights, as well as potential damage to the airline’s reputation.

Comprehensive Engine Health Monitoring

EOne of the key benefits of early consultation is the implementation of comprehensive engine health monitoring, such as Engine Condition Trend Monitoring (ECTM). In many cases small airlines do not have the in-house resources to consistently track engine performance metrics, but EMC providers can step in with advanced data analytics and monitoring tools. These tools continuously assess engine performance, tracking key indicators like Inter Turbine Temperature (ITT), Exhaust Gast Temperature (EGT), the pressures p2 and p3, and vibration levels to predict when components might fail.

The analysis of real-time data not only helps avoid immediate failures but also allows for strategic planning of maintenance schedules, e.g. by staggering of engine removals. For example, an EMC services provider can use predictive analytics to identify that a specific engine part will likely need replacement e.g. within the 500 flight hours, allowing the airline to budget and schedule the repair during a planned downtime, rather than dealing with an emergency repair during peak season.

Negotiating Maintenance Contracts

Establishing engine maintenance contracts can be a serious challenge for any airline, particularly when negotiating with large maintenance service providers or engine OEMs. Without expert guidance, airlines may end up in a commitment to an unfavorable contract with hidden fees, costly penalties, or restrictive terms that don’t cater to their specific needs.

An EMC provider brings valuable expertise to the negotiation table. With in-depth knowledge of industry standards and pricing models, EMC consultants can help small airlines secure better terms in their maintenance agreements. This may include preferential parts pricing, the option to supply parts, negotiating lower hourly rates, extended warranties, or more flexible service schedules that accommodate the airline’s operational patterns. By avoiding common contract pitfalls, small airlines can significantly reduce maintenance costs while ensuring high-quality service for their engines.

Early Consultation Avoids Major Engine Overhaul

A small regional airline operating a fleet of six aircraft faced an unexpected engine malfunction that could have led to a $500,000 overhaul. The airline, lacking in-house expertise, turned to an EMC provider for an early consultation. Through a thorough engine inspection and performance analysis, the EMC team discovered a developing issue with a critical component. Instead of waiting for a costly, full-scale inspection and cost estimate, the EMC specialists recommended a minimum workscope repair, which was completed during a scheduled maintenance window.

As a result, the airline pushed back on the requirement for an extensive overhaul, saving both time and a significant amount of money. By acting early and proactively, they minimized downtime, preventing flight cancellations and maintaining their reputation for reliability.

Customized EMC Solution Saves 20 % on Maintenance Costs

Another success story involves a small airline with a fleet of eight aircraft. The airline faced rising maintenance costs and struggled with frequent unscheduled engine removals, which impacted their budget, cash-flow and operational efficiency. After partnering with an EMC provider, the airline underwent a detailed fleet analysis. The EMC team developed a customized maintenance plan that was tailored to the airline’s specific usage patterns, operational demands and engine fleet.

This tailored approach not only reduced unnecessary maintenance checks but also optimized the timing of engine inspections and repairs. Within the first year, the airline saw a 20 % reduction in overall maintenance costs. By aligning maintenance schedules with actual engine performance, they were able to avoid over-maintenance and reduce unscheduled removals, resulting in significant cost savings and improved fleet availability.

Predictive Analytics Prevents In-Flight Engine Failure

A third case highlights how predictive analytics from an EMC provider prevented a potentially catastrophic in-flight engine failure. A small airline with five aircraft integrated Engine Condition Trend Monitoring (ECTM) into their operations with the assistance of their EMC provider. The EMC team used predictive analytics to track engine performance data, identifying patterns of degradation that would have gone unnoticed in a typical visual inspection.

During a routine review of engine data, the EMC team flagged a sudden change in performance metrics for one of the aircraft’s engines. This anomaly suggested an imminent failure of a key component. The airline was able to ground the aircraft and address the issue before it led to an in-flight emergency. By preventing a failure that could have resulted in a forced landing or worse, the airline not only avoided major repair costs but also safeguarded passenger safety and protected its reputation.
